Output 315b94f33d9d6ea37178b4a4177f1b78a65aaf93d2b8ce8cc85e6a35acc3b394:0

value
4709646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25df663c4fbf38ed7caeda2efd41b66eef13e54e OP_EQUAL
address
359GYhcLrtDQdcFGJdqYwZkNLnwTdwUczn
transaction
315b94f33d9d6ea37178b4a4177f1b78a65aaf93d2b8ce8cc85e6a35acc3b394
spent
true